Artur Grigoryan (Saxophonist)

Artur is the award winning saxophonist and composer. Graduated from the Yerevan State Conservatory with BA in music and studied at Berklee College of Music in Boston (USA). He formed “Art Voices” ethno-jazz group and won a Grand prize at 2009 Bucharest International Jazz Competition. As a sideman he appeared at Yerevan, Kavkaz, Bucharest and Paris jazz festivals. As well as World- music festivals in Germany, Poland and Austria (with Reincarnation band). Currently residing in Dubai he works as the member of Music Hall band at the most famous music show in the Middle East and the North Africa. He is also one of the founders of A.R.S trio which recorded its debut album “Time” in 2014. The same year Artur got an invitation to participate at Kavkaz jazz Festival with A.R.S trio. From 2015 he cooperats with the Indian ethno jazz fusion band “Voyage” with which he participated at NH7 Bacardi Weekender Festivals and toured in Mumbai Calcutta Pune and Bangalore. Also, they played in Oslo and other European cities. In 2000 he recorded and released the first full-length album under his name. “Good Intension” album was presented already in Dubai, Moscow and now the turn of Yerevan comes.
